The Complete 5-Email Black Friday Sequence for PPC Specialists
As a ppc specialist, your clients trust your recommendations. This 5-email sequence helps you introduce valuable tools without sounding like a salesperson.
The Early Bird
Tease the sale before it starts
Hi [First Name],
The holiday season rush is almost here, and with it, the intense pressure to deliver even bigger results for your clients. You know the feeling: juggling multiple accounts, improving bids, and still finding time to strategize.
It often feels like there aren't enough hours in the day to give every campaign the attention it deserves. What if you could gain a significant edge without adding to your workload?
What if there was a way to make your services even more compelling for clients looking to maximize their year-end spend? Next [DAY OF WEEK], we're revealing a special opportunity designed to help PPC specialists like you achieve exactly that.
It's something you won't want to miss. Keep an eye on your inbox.
Best, [YOUR NAME]
This email uses curiosity and the 'information gap' theory. By hinting at a solution to a common pain point without revealing specifics, it creates a psychological need for the reader to open future emails to satisfy their curiosity. It also positions the sender as someone who understands their challenges.
The Reveal
Announce the full Black Friday offer
Hi [First Name],
The wait is over. Our Black Friday offer is live, and it’s built specifically to help PPC specialists to achieve more with less effort.
We know you're constantly seeking ways to improve performance, enhance client reporting, and find those extra hours in your week. This year, we're making it easier than ever to access [PRODUCT NAME], the solution that helps you automate client updates, identify optimization opportunities, and manage campaign budgets more effectively.
For a limited time, you can get [PRODUCT NAME] with a special Black Friday incentive. This is your chance to simplify your workflow and deliver even stronger results for your clients heading into the new year.
Don't let this opportunity pass. Upgrade your toolkit and stay ahead of the curve. [CTA: See the Black Friday Offer →]
Best, [YOUR NAME]
This email uses the 'scarcity principle' by highlighting a 'limited time' offer, compelling immediate action. It directly addresses the PPC specialist's core desires (optimization, reporting, time-saving) and frames the product as an essential 'upgrade' for their professional toolkit, appealing to their desire for competence and efficiency.
The Reminder
Midday reminder for those who missed it
Hi [First Name],
I know how hectic Black Friday can be, especially when you're managing multiple client campaigns. It's easy for important updates to get lost in the shuffle.
But I wanted to make sure you didn't miss our special Black Friday offer for [PRODUCT NAME]. It's designed to help you cut down on manual reporting, free up time for strategic planning, and provide deeper insights for clients.
Many PPC specialists are already taking advantage of this to refine their processes and enhance their client services. This isn't just about a deal; it's about investing in a solution that genuinely improves your daily operations and client outcomes.
The offer won't last forever. Take a moment to explore how [PRODUCT NAME] can transform your approach to PPC management. [CTA: Review the Black Friday Offer →]
Best, [YOUR NAME]
This email employs 'social proof' by mentioning 'many PPC specialists are already taking advantage,' which validates the offer and encourages conformity. It also uses 'loss aversion' by framing the missed opportunity as a potential setback for their operations and client outcomes, rather than just missing a discount.
The Extended
Weekend extension for hesitaters
Hi [First Name],
Black Friday weekend often flies by, filled with client calls, campaign adjustments, and perhaps a little personal shopping. If you haven't had a moment to consider our special offer, I have good news.
We've decided to extend our Black Friday pricing for [PRODUCT NAME] through Cyber Monday. This gives you a little extra breathing room to evaluate how our solution can genuinely benefit your agency and your clients.
Think about the time you could reclaim from tedious tasks, or the enhanced insights you could provide your clients. [PRODUCT NAME] is built to address those exact challenges, helping you focus on high-impact strategic work. This extension is the final opportunity to secure this special rate.
Don't let the last chance slip away to give your services a significant boost. [CTA: Access the Extended Offer Now →]
Best, [YOUR NAME]
This email utilizes the principle of 'reciprocity' by offering an extension, making the reader feel valued and understood. It also re-establishes 'urgency' with a new, clear deadline, countering potential procrastination and providing a final push for decision-making without aggressive pressure.
The Final Call
Cyber Monday last chance
Hi [First Name],
This is it. The absolute final hours to secure our Black Friday pricing for [PRODUCT NAME].
Tonight, at [TIME ZONE], this special opportunity will be gone. We know how critical it is to have the right tools to deliver exceptional results for your clients in a competitive . [PRODUCT NAME] is designed to be that essential tool, helping you improve reporting, improve campaign performance, and scale client accounts efficiently.
Consider the impact on your workflow, your client satisfaction, and your agency's growth. Missing this offer means continuing with your current processes, potentially leaving valuable time and opportunities on the table.
Don't let this chance pass you by. Make a strategic decision for your agency before the clock runs out. [CTA: Claim Your Offer Before It's Gone →]
Best, [YOUR NAME]
This email creates extreme 'scarcity' and 'loss aversion.' By emphasizing a definitive, imminent deadline and the 'cost of inaction,' it triggers a strong psychological response to avoid missing out on a perceived valuable opportunity. The 'endowment effect' is also at play, where the reader has already invested mental energy in considering the offer, making the thought of losing it more effective.
4 Black Friday Sequence Mistakes PPC Specialists Make
| Don't Do This | Do This Instead |
|---|---|
✕ Manually compiling performance reports across multiple platforms for each client. | Implement a CRM or a dedicated reporting tool that integrates with ad platforms to automate data collection and report generation, saving hours each week. |
✕ Treating all client communication as ad-hoc, leading to missed updates or inconsistent messaging. | Utilize an email marketing tool or CRM to create structured communication sequences for client onboarding, monthly updates, and special offers, ensuring consistent and timely information. |
✕ Neglecting to proactively educate clients on new ad features or strategic shifts. | Integrate regular, value-driven educational content into your client communication strategy, positioning yourself as a thought leader and enhancing client retention. |
✕ Failing to schedule regular, dedicated time for strategic campaign reviews and adjustments. | Use scheduling software to block out specific times for deep-dive analysis and optimization, treating it as non-negotiable client work to improve campaign performance. |

Google Ads Specialists
- Master Performance Max campaigns for broader reach and automation.
- Deepen your understanding of Google Analytics 4 for advanced conversion tracking and audience insights.
- Refine automated bidding strategies by clearly defining conversion values and goals.
Facebook Ads Specialists
- Continuously A/B test creative variations and ad copy to identify top performers.
- Use Facebook's Audience Insights tool for granular targeting and new audience discovery.
- Implement the Conversion API for more reliable data tracking amidst privacy changes.
Amazon PPC Specialists
- Improve Sponsored Products and Brands campaigns with negative keywords and precise targeting.
- Utilize Product Targeting to reach shoppers browsing complementary or competitor products.
- Focus on ACoS (Advertising Cost of Sale) optimization by analyzing keyword performance and bid adjustments.
Programmatic Specialists
- Refine audience segmentation strategies using first-party data and look-alike audiences.
- Explore advanced data management platforms (DMPs) to centralize and activate audience data effectively.
- Prioritize brand safety measures and viewability metrics to ensure quality ad placements.
